Anyone know where to score some good 3 cell LiPo packs? What's a good charger (cheap version) for LiPo. I've got the 959, but doubt that will work. I'm looking to go brushless in a couple 1/18th scale cars, and would like at least a couple LiPo packs. Anyone know where to get them at a reasonable price? Thanks.

Hi.. I myself drive a Mini-T with at Lehner BL motor and ESC.

I use Polymer 3 cell 11.1V packs also. I bought mine from www.b-p-p.com.

They have great service. An example of that is that my first shipment (I live in Denmark) got lost during shipping some how, but they send me another no questions asked.

Regarding getting some "cheap" Polymer packs I really don't know. They all seem to cost approx. the same.

Regarding the charger: Please!! do not use a cheap-o charger for theese cells. They are not to be handled carelessly. I use the Triton from Great Planes. It can be bought from $100 - 120 almost anywhere.. I also charges all my other batts for other cars/home.

I run electric for the fun only also. I'm normally into nitro, but with that said I would hate to se my polys/living room go up in flames just because I didn't spend the last $20-30.

Its the 2-4+ packs of polymer cells that is going to cost anyway.

Btw. The Triton sharges NiCD & NiMH @ 5 AMPS and Polymer @ 2.5 A.

If the charger you mention is this http://www2.towerhobbies.com/cgi-bin/wti0001p?&I=LXCTZ5&P=ML

Then I would not use it for charging Polys. It is deigned for Lithium-ION and it has a different chemical construction, hence charging pattern. I have a friend who ruined one polymer cell (from ThunderPower) using this charger. He/we wrote to Hobbico and they also said not to charge polymers with it.

Btw. it was a 1900 mAh 11.1V sharged at 1A on the above charger.
